This post offers an exciting opportunity to join the radiology department at Eccleshill Community Diagnostic Centre.

Due to current Home Office Guidelines, Bradford Teaching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ust is unable to provide sponsorship for this role.

The successful applicants will work with our friendly team of Radiographers, Sonographers, Radiologists, and other support staff, in our busy and dynamic department, to fulfill the commitment to provide a high quality service to patients undergoing diagnostic procedures.

They will assist with preparing patients for their CT, MR or ultrasound scans and care for them during and after their examinations. There will be a need to cannulate some of these patients and/or take blood samples for testing. A flexible approach and a strong work ethic in this busy environment is required to meet the needs of the service.

Main duties of the job

As a Radiographic Assistant your main role would be to provide care to patients attending for diagnostic imaging tests across a wide range of modalities including CT, MRI and Ultrasound. You will support staff while they are performing the scans and support/ chaperone the patients throughout their appointment journey.

You will contribute as part of the imaging team to the diagnostic imaging process, maintaining high standards of care, competence, professional manner, punctuality and appearance.

Maintain and take part in departmental stock control.

Perform cannulation and venepuncture.

Summary of most important Experience/Skills/Qualifications required:

Previous experience in clinical healthcare setting such as a care home, community or hospital setting. NVQ/QCF Diploma or Apprenticeship at Level 2 or equivalent in Care is essential as is previous experience of working as a carer in a care home, community care or hospital setting. Good verbal and written command of English, Maths and I.T. skills are a requirement. Excellent interpersonal skills and attention to detail are essential. Smart appearance and pleasant professional manner.
